§ 31-539 — Sanitary district; activities; discontinuance; effect on contract rights

Text

Except as otherwise provided in section 31-543 , all lawful claims, rights, and demands against such a district, and all contractual obligations of such a district, existing in any person at the time of discontinuance of the activities and work of such district, shall continue to subsist in such person and shall remain the charge and obligation of the sanitary district, and all claims and demands in favor of such district at the time of the discontinuance of its activities and work shall subsist in its favor and may be collected in the same manner as might have been theretofore done by the district.

Legislative History

Source: Laws 1941, c. 56, § 4, p. 256; C.S.Supp.,1941, § 31-633; R.S.1943, § 31-539; Laws 2022, LB800, § 333.
